Q:   How to pursue Criminal Law as a profession after class 12th?
A: 

Candidates need to get a bachelor's in law then pursue LLM in Criminal Law. To become a lawyer, candidates need to take the bar exam. It is a state-level exam that must be passed before you can practice law in India. You must have finished an LLB program from an approved university to be able to take the bar exam. After passing the bar test, you can apply for criminal law jobs at government agencies, private law firms, and non-profit organizations.

Q:   What are some of the recent changes to Criminal Law in India?
A: 

Some of the recent changes to criminal law in India are based on some recent henious crimes, which are made looking at the intensities in these crimes. These changes are mentioned below: 

  • The Criminal Law (Amendment) Act, 2013, this Act made a number of changes to the IPC and the CrPC, including the introduction of new offenses such as stalking and acid attacks.
  • The Juvenile Justice (Care and Protection of Children) Act, 2015, which raised the age of juvenile delinquency from 16 to 18 years.
  • The Protection of Children from Sexual Offences Act, 2012, which introduced new offenses related to child sexual abuse.

Q:   Which one is better among criminology and criminal law?
A: 

Let's understand the key difference between Criminal Law and Criminology, in brief: 

CharacteristicCriminal LawCriminology
Focus
Criminal law is the body of law that deals with crimes and their punishment. It is concerned with the protection of society from harmful individuals and conduct. Criminal law is enforced by the state through the police and the courts.
Criminology is the scientific study of crime. Criminologists are interested in understanding the causes and consequences of crime, as well as developing strategies for crime prevention and rehabilitation.
DisciplinesLaw, sociology, psychology
Sociology, psychology, criminal justice, economics
MethodsCase studies, legal analysisSurveys, interviews, statistical analysis
GoalsTo deter crime and punish criminals
To develop strategies for crime prevention and rehabilitation
ExamplesA Criminal Lawyer might represent a client accused of murder in court.
A Criminologist might study the relationship between poverty and crime in a community.

Q:   What is the difference between criminal science, criminal law and criminology?
A: 

Criminology is a social Science. Closely related to psychology and sociology - the study of human behavior in context of crimes/criminal behavior. Here we understand the how, why, when & where of crime. Criminal justice runs on the application of criminology. Criminal justice enforces these solutions from criminology. Criminal justice students study the inner workings of the justice and law enforcement systems from its inception to its structures and role in society today. Coming to criminal law, here one learns how to leverage legal framework of the country to serve justice to those affected by the crimes persisting in a society.
